97             Bodegas Vega-Sicilia     Ribera del Duero Unico Reserva Especial
In an ideal world, anyone who approaches a border crossing into Spain would receive a drop of Unico Reserva Especial on their tongue, resetting their entire system to work in Spanish. This is the most Spanish of wines, needing only a slice of jamón Iberico or a crisp bite of lechazo to deliver complete Castilian bliss. The latest release, assembled by Gonzalo Iturriaga and his team from their reserves of Unico in the 2009, 2011 and 2012 vintages, is a plump, savory beauty. It resonates in a subtle chord of flavor, working through major and minor keys as it lasts, spicy and dynamic, defining elegance. The flavors shapeshift from bitter chocolate to black currant, a whiff of freshness in scents of tomato leaf and purple sage. Compellingly delicious, this is the vinous aristocracy of Spain. Europvin USA, Van Nuys, CA

95             Bodegas Vega-Sicilia     2013 Ribera del Duero Unico
The 2013 season was relatively mild and dry, at least until harvest, when the rains came on from the end of September through mid-October. The 100 acres of vines for Unico grow on a north-facing hillside, the remnants of an ancient lake bed, its sediments combining sand and clay flecked with crystallized gypsum. The soil’s ability to manage water, along with the vines’ adaptation to the site for 40, 60 or 80 years, delivered a beautiful 2013, a silken pleasure, fragrant with fresh fruit and violet scents. The lasting impression is complex, melding notes of pipe tobacco, black mushroom umami, red currant, red meat and flamed orange peel. The dry tannins take the gentle well of dark fruits toward tension in the end, making this a keeper. Europvin USA, Van Nuys, CA

94             La Vieja Cepa     2015 Ribera del Duero Marques de Uros
Arnaldo Rodriguez and his family farm 37 acres in La Horra, most of the vines planted in the early 1950s, with the youngest planted in 1961. Their Selección Especial in 2015 is bright blue fruit on top, with some green herb notes. Then the flavors run deeper, integrating mineral-rich tannins into blueberry-skin blackness, those tannins strong without feeling aggressive. From a ripe vintage, this is gracious and easy to love. Classic Wines, Stamford, CT

94             Vizcarra     $334     2015 Ribera del Duero Gran Reserva Torralvo
Juan Carlos Vizcarra blends his best barrels into Torralvo, working with fruit from his 11 parcels of vines in Mambrilla de Castrejón (Burgos), planted more than 60 years ago. This is a serious, old-school tempranillo, needing a decade or more of cellar time to reach its peak expression. For now, the wine is substantial and long, the fruit infused into the limestone abrasion of the tannins. As powerful and austere as those tannins may be, the fruit continues to show through them; as the finish continues, you can breathe the fruit through the tannins, providing a vision of what the wine will become. Olé & Obrigado, New Rochelle, NY

93             Cillar de Silos     $25     2020 Ribera del Duero Cillar Vendimia Seleccionada Tempranillo
From high-altitude vineyards (over 2800 feet) in Quintana del Pidio, this is a wine of quiet elegance, presenting the power of Ribera del Duero without excess. Its floral red fruit—red plums and roses—integrates with the fruitiness of woodland mushrooms, giving the wine umami richness that lasts. Round and integrated, this is ready to enjoy now. Alt Wines, Coral Gables, FL

93             Emilio Moro     $192     2018 Ribera del Duero Malleolus de Sanchomartin Tempranillo
The Moro family farms this parcel in Pesquera de Duero, planted in 1944, producing a silken and elegant wine in 2018. You can feel the cold nights in the grape-skin spice of the tannins, black and lasting on notes of cracked peppercorns and strawberry seeds. Decant a bottle for roast baby lamb. Moro Brothers/USA Wine West, Sausalito, CA

93             Penalba Herraiz     $30     2016 Ribera del Duero Carravid
While he manages more than 600 acres of vines, Miguel Angel Peñalba makes his own wines from 23 acres he farms near Aranda del Duero, certified organic. Carravid is his flagship red, aged more than a year in French oak barrels (80 percent new). That time in oak completes the wine richness that begins with dark fruit—blueberry and black currant—the wine zesty in its plump berry flavor and elegant in its lasting savory notes of tobacco. Grapes of Spain, Lorton, VA

93             Hnos. Pérez Pascuas     $115     2016 Ribera del Duero Gran Reserva Vina Pedrosa
Based in Pedrosa de Duero, northwest of Roa, the Pérez Pascuas family farms close to 300 acres of vineyards. They select this wine from 60-year-old vines, aging it for two years in barrel, then at least three years in bottle. It’s stately, an old-fashioned Ribera del Duero with plump, anise-scented fruit. That purple fruit flavor runs deep, lasting past the warmth of the wine. A gracious red for pork braised with fennel. Think Global Wines, Santa Barbara, CA

93             Dominio del Pidio     $100     2020 Ribera del Duero
This is a project from Oscar and Robert Aragón, brothers who also work at their family’s winery, Cillar de Silos (their 2020 Cillar Vendimia Seleccionada is also recommended here). They restored the 16th-century cellars in Quintana del Pidio that once served the local monastery. Their 2020 is light and fresh with delicate red fruit scents that last. There’s a bitter baking-chocolate note to the tannins, the wine having aged for 16 months in French oak barrels, 60 feet underground. It’s a Ribera del Duero with stamina, driving forward, leaving a breath of fresh air in its wake. Alt Wines, Coral Gables, FL

93             Resalte de Penafiel     $257     Ribera del Duero Essences Cuvee No. 2
This is a blend of several vintages from the bodega’s stock, selected for longevity and aged in large French oak casks. Potently structured, the wine still feels welcoming in its blueberry flavors, while chalky tannins give it life and lift. Those tannins keep their grip on the finish, the black fruit lasting past them with scents of roses to match the freshness of the tannins. MC Elite, Miami, FL

92             Neo     $30     2021 Ribera del Duero El Arte de Vivir Tempranillo
This wine’s substance and power build out of a salty savor in the tannins, as cool fruit depths rise like a wave of flavor, richly, elaborately structured. There’s lots of cumin spice on the fruit without feeling oaken, lasting with a sweet apricot high note. W.Direct, Lawrence, KS

92             Torres     $25     2019 Ribera del Duero Celeste Crianza
Grown near Fompedraza, south of Peñafiel, this is a wine of indulgent richness, its vibrant red-currant and strawberry flavors turning purple in the shadow of blue-black tannins. There are no edges to it, the wine needing time to come into focus with air. It has a summery tomato-skin undertone giving a sunny warmth. Wilson Daniels, Napa, CA

92             Valdevinas     $45     2005 Ribera del Duero Tinar de Mirat
Based in Langa de Duero, in the eastern hills of Ribera del Duero, Valdeviñas works with its own vineyards as well as small plots of old vines around the village. This late release has reached sweet maturity while the fruit still feels vibrant, with notes of blueberries and bergamot. The soft texture is beginning to show the wine’s age at the edges. For drinking now with roast lamb. Spanish Wine Exclusives, NY

92             Vega Clara     $37     2020 Ribera del Duero Mario
Clara Concejo founded her winery in Quintanilla de Onésimo (Valladolid), the town where most of her 29.6 acres of vines are located. It’s in the western side of Ribera del Duero, and the fruit of the wine has a vertical freshness, a foresty character, as if looking to the Atlantic, noted panelist Nacho Monclús. There’s purity to the currant flavor, supported by oak behind the fruit. An immediate, easy pleasure. Classic Wines, Stamford, CT

92             Vilano     $55     2019 Ribera del Duero Reserva
There’s a positive charge to this wine’s pomegranate-red fruit, the tannins oaky in their coffee-bean richness, lending a sleek, sumptuous texture along with a spice, like fenugreek. It feels Moorish-Iberian, with a sweet blackberry density for North African dishes. W.Direct, Lawrence, KS

91             Alberto y Benito     $18     2019 Ribera del Duero Briego Tiempo Crianza
A blend of fruit from vineyards near Peñafiel (at elevations around 2450 feet) and south of the river, in Fompedraza (close to 3,000 feet), this wine initially takes a Bretty direction with horse-stable scents. Then there’s plenty of black cherry-skin flavor and floral notes coming through in the end. The acidity keeps it fresh, lasting on tannic tension. Kraynick & Associates, Royersford, PA

91             Malcaracter     $42     2020 Ribera del Duero Limited Tempranillo
This needs time to come together, presenting contradictions at first, fresh cherry and fruit leather, flamed orange zest, mustard seed and chocolate. With a day of air, it settles into cool blueberry fruit, a velvet nap of tannins integrating the spice into underlying richness. Copa Fina, Oakland, CA

91             Finca Rodma     $51     2020 Ribera del Duero Avizor
Based on the western side of the region, Rodma farms 34 acres of vines, its parcels ranging in altitude from 2,100 to 3,200 feet. This wine seems to show that higher altitude in superripe fruit that’s not jammy, the fruit foresty, the tannins black. Its complexity mirrors the flavors of sautéed mushrooms served over beef. Toros & Vinos, Miami, FL

91             Valparaiso     $19     2020 Ribera del Duero Crianza Romero de Aranda Tempranillo
Refreshingly cool, this wine’s fresh red-plum flavors pour out of the glass, followed by black plum-skin tannins that last. The fruit enlivens that tense, tannic grip, and both will enliven a char-grilled steak. W.Direct, Lawrence, KS

91             Vega Clara     $150     2019 Ribera del Duero Dacan
From the 80-year-old vines at Pago de Valtarreña in Pedrosa de Duero, Dacán shows its time in new French oak with toasty scents and savory wood influences of soy sauce. It’s an ambitious wine with plenty of fruit to stand up to the oak—indulgent, hedonistic, as one panelist said. There’s a dry feel to the tannins even as the wine has concentration, guts and staying power. Classic Wines, Stamford, CT

91             Vilano     $42     2020 Ribera del Duero Crianza
This is a tight, floral and herbal Ribera del Duero, its youthful character charged with jammy black-raspberry fruit and bloody, purple tannins. Austere and grippy, this needs bottle age to mellow. W.Direct, Lawrence, KS

91             Vilano     $30     2021 Ribera del Duero Roble
With plush black-currant flavors edged in scents of rose petal and rusty acidity, this is a savory, earthy red. Acidity rounds out the richness of the fruit, a mouthwatering match for grilled chopped sirloin. W.Direct, Lawrence, KS

91             Hermanos del Villar     $18     2020 Ribera del Duero Crianza Oro de Castilla
Plump and quiet in its red fruit, earthy and gentle in its green-edged tannins, this is a warm Ribera del Duero with a sense of elegance: A steal for $18. Olé & Obrigado, New Rochelle, NY

91             Vizcarra     $158     2019 Ribera del Duero Celia
Juan Carlos Vizcarra selects this fruit from the oldest tinto fino vines at his family’s vineyards, including 7 percent grenache in the blend. Aged in mostly new French oak barrels for 18 months, this yields exotic scents of rain-forest fruit, violets, tamari and cinnamon—complicated as a young wine, needing age to mellow its iron and tar-black tannins and transform the lean red-currant fruit matrix into complexity. Olé & Obrigado, New Rochelle, NY

90             Bodega S. Arroyo     $60     2015 Ribera del Duero Senorio de Sotillo
There’s tannic density and black-cherry flavor at the core of this wine, needing air to move past its chocolate-mint scents toward umami savor. Earthiness comes up with fruity mushroom tones; a wine to decant for grilled meats. Vinamericas, Miami, FL

90             Bodegas Cepa 21     $62     2019 Ribera del Duero Malabrigo
This is a selection from a vineyard in Castrillo de Duero, offering perfumed red fruit and briny, fruit-skin tannins, hinting at black olives. Those lovely fruit tannins last, weighed down by French oak tannins for now, needing bottle age to work past its waxy oak. USA Wine West, Sausalito, CA

90             Casa Lebai     $115     2020 Ribera del Duero La Nava Albillo Mayor
Though this vineyard was planted in 1940, it was not legal to label the wine Ribera del Duero until 80 years later (the region changed its regulations in October 2019). This old-vine albillo mayor ferments in concrete eggs and ages in 500-liter French oak barrels, converting its ripeness and warmth into intriguing spice, layered over scents of buttercream, crab apple and persimmon bread. Match its perfumed richness and airy length to veal sausages or roast turkey. Grapes of Spain, Lorton, VA

90             Neo     $31     2021 Ribera del Duero Disco
Floral honey and wild-blueberry scents show off this wine’s lively freshness. It feels crisply lined with green tannins and cool acidity, while the fruit is gentle with a creamy texture in the middle. W.Direct, Lawrence, KS

90             Hnos. Pérez Pascuas     $60     2018 Ribera del Duero Reserva Vina Pedrosa
This smells like a flourless chocolate cake, dark and savory, a rich and luxurious wine with some bitter spice to the dry and austere tannins. There's heat in the end, needing cellar time to open past the tannins. Think Global Wines, Santa Barbara, CA

90             Protos     $30     2020 Ribera del Duero 27 Tinto Fino
Brightened by the pink-peppercorn spiciness to its high notes of red and green fruit, this is full and rich, deepened by blueberry savor and saturated with oak char. The oak recedes with air, as the wine melds its char with warm cherry fruit. Monsieur Touton Selection, NY

90             Resalte de Penafiel     $30     2020 Ribera del Duero Origen de Resalte
The structure of this wine is somehow imperceptible, even as it holds the plump fruit in a crisp line. It feels ambitiously oaked, but it’s not an oak bomb, offering plenty of ripe fruit to absorb the scents of baking spice and vanilla. The structure does show itself in the end, where the oak tannins last, needing a year or two in bottle to fully meld. Terroir Connections, Miami, FL

90             Sei Solo     $108     2019 Ribera del Duero
This is Javier Zacccagnini’s selection from two vineyards in La Horra, where the vines are more than 60 years old. The wine ages for 20 months in used 600-liter French oak barrels, and though the oak is prominent, scents of cherry blossoms and flavors of red fruit drive through it. There’s a spicy pink-peppercorn edge to the tannins, layered into the rich, voluptuous texture. Kysela Père & Fils, Winchester, VA

90             Sei Solo     $56     2019 Ribera del Duero Preludio
The fruit of bush vines in La Horra, Gumiel de Izan and Moradillo, some young, others reaching up to 80 years old, this aged in large-format French oak barrels (50 percent new). The wine’s oak presence is strong, but the fruit is equally strong, black and tarry, like a plum-skin syrup, merging with the oak in notes of tobacco smoke. A classical, grippy black wine from Ribera del Duero, it has edges to it, making room for blackened duck. Kysela Père & Fils, Winchester, VA

90             Tinto Pesquera     $40     2020 Ribera del Duero Crianza
Black cherry and fresh tobacco scents lift this wine out of its warm fruit flavors of jammy blueberries. Soft and cushioned, with oak in the background, this is mature and ready to drink. Folio Fine Wine, Napa, CA

90             Virtus     $120     2016 Ribera del Duero Gran Reserva
Full-on acidity and mineral tannins combine with this wine’s slightly syrupy fruit, delivering a pure blueberry flavor. A selection from parcels in La Horra and Hontoria de Valdearados, the vines more than 60 years old, this is a rustic, lean Ribera del Duero with some old-fashioned charm. W.Direct, Lawrence, KS
